1975 Alpine A 310 vs. 1999 Hyundai Lantra
To start off, 1999 Hyundai Lantra is newer by 24 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1975 Alpine A 310.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1975 Alpine A 310 would be higher. At 1,604 cc (4 cylinders), 1975 Alpine A 310 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1975 Alpine A 310 (127 HP @ 6250 RPM) has 40 more horse power than 1999 Hyundai Lantra. (87 HP @ 5500 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1975 Alpine A 310 should accelerate faster than 1999 Hyundai Lantra.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1999 Hyundai Lantra weights approximately 270 kg more than 1975 Alpine A 310.
Because 1975 Alpine A 310 is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1975 Alpine A 310.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1999 Hyundai Lantra,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1975 Alpine A 310 (146 Nm @ 5000 RPM) has 18 more torque (in Nm) than 1999 Hyundai Lantra. (128 Nm @ 4300 RPM). This means 1975 Alpine A 310 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1999 Hyundai Lantra.
Compare all specifications:
1975 Alpine A 310 | 1999 Hyundai Lantra | |
Make | Alpine | Hyundai |
Model | A 310 | Lantra |
Year Released | 1975 | 1999 |
Engine Position | Rear | Front |
Engine Size | 1604 cc | 1495 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 127 HP | 87 HP |
Engine RPM | 6250 RPM | 5500 RPM |
Torque | 146 Nm | 128 Nm |
Torque RPM | 5000 RPM | 4300 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 4 seats | 4 seats |
Vehicle Weight | 825 kg | 1095 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4190 mm | 4460 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1630 mm | 1710 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1160 mm | 1460 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2280 mm | 2560 mm |
